WDBO Sports Director Scott Anez has again been voted the #1 Radio Sportscaster of the Year by Orlando Magazine readers. Scott is a native to the Central Florida area. He graduated high school from Lake Brantley in Altamonte Springs and he earned his broadcasting degree from the University of Central Florida. He began his career at WDBO in1991 when he joined in with Jim Turner on "Central Florida's Morning News" as the Sports Director and he has been continuing his success ever since. Scott is also the host of Inside Magic during the NBA season. If you want to hear the latest news about the Orlando Magic, tune in because he is up on the entire scoop!
